p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/devel/glib2 update to 2.16.3



details:   https://anonhg.NetBSD.org/pkgsrc/rev/384be7d1bea3
branches:  trunk
changeset: 540900:384be7d1bea3
user:      drochner <drochner%pkgsrc.org@localhost>
date:      Thu Apr 10 12:13:49 2008 +0000

description:
update to 2.16.3
This switches to the gnome-2.22 release branch.

diffstat:

 devel/glib2/Makefile         |   18 +++-
 devel/glib2/PLIST            |  146 +++++++++++++++++++++++++++++++++++++++++-
 devel/glib2/distinfo         |   15 ++--
 devel/glib2/patches/patch-aa |   40 +++++------
 devel/glib2/patches/patch-af |   10 +-
 devel/glib2/patches/patch-ag |   10 +-
 devel/glib2/patches/patch-ba |   30 ++++++++
 7 files changed, 221 insertions(+), 48 deletions(-)

diffs (truncated from 536 to 300 lines):

diff -r af15be1412e8 -r 384be7d1bea3 devel/glib2/Makefile
--- a/devel/glib2/Makefile      Thu Apr 10 12:13:32 2008 +0000
+++ b/devel/glib2/Makefile      Thu Apr 10 12:13:49 2008 +0000
@@ -1,13 +1,13 @@
-# $NetBSD: Makefile,v 1.131 2008/02/21 20:53:54 tnn Exp $
+# $NetBSD: Makefile,v 1.132 2008/04/10 12:13:49 drochner Exp $
 
 # When updating glib2, please apply patch-ak to configure.in
 # Then run a matching version of autoconf to regen patch-aa.
-DISTNAME=              glib-2.14.6
+DISTNAME=              glib-2.16.3
 PKGNAME=               ${DISTNAME:S/glib/glib2/}
 CATEGORIES=            devel
-MASTER_SITES=          ftp://ftp.gtk.org/pub/glib/2.14/ \
-                       ftp://ftp.cs.umn.edu/pub/gimp/pub/glib/2.14/ \
-                       ${MASTER_SITE_GNOME:=sources/glib/2.14/}
+MASTER_SITES=          ftp://ftp.gtk.org/pub/glib/2.16/ \
+                       ftp://ftp.cs.umn.edu/pub/gimp/pub/glib/2.16/ \
+                       ${MASTER_SITE_GNOME:=sources/glib/2.16/}
 EXTRACT_SUFX=          .tar.bz2
 
 MAINTAINER=            pkgsrc-users%NetBSD.org@localhost
@@ -34,6 +34,8 @@
 PKGCONFIG_OVERRIDE+=   gobject-2.0.pc.in
 PKGCONFIG_OVERRIDE+=   gthread-2.0-uninstalled.pc.in
 PKGCONFIG_OVERRIDE+=   gthread-2.0.pc.in
+PKGCONFIG_OVERRIDE+=   gio-2.0.pc.in
+PKGCONFIG_OVERRIDE+=   gio-unix-2.0.pc.in
 
 GNU_CONFIGURE=         yes
 CONFIGURE_ENV+=                PKGLOCALEDIR=${PKGLOCALEDIR:Q}
@@ -51,6 +53,11 @@
 
 .include "../../mk/bsd.prefs.mk"
 
+.if ${OPSYS} == "NetBSD"
+# configure detects wrongly
+CONFIGURE_ENV+=                ac_cv_func_statfs=no
+.endif
+
 CPPFLAGS+=             -DPREFIX="\"${PREFIX}\""
 CPPFLAGS+=             -DPKGLOCALEDIR="\"${PKGLOCALEDIR}\""
 CPPFLAGS+=             -DPKG_SYSCONFDIR="\"${PKG_SYSCONFDIR}\""
@@ -91,5 +98,6 @@
 .include "../../mk/pthread.buildlink3.mk"
 .endif
 .include "../../devel/pcre/buildlink3.mk"
+.include "../../mk/fam.buildlink3.mk"
 
 .include "../../mk/bsd.pkg.mk"
diff -r af15be1412e8 -r 384be7d1bea3 devel/glib2/PLIST
--- a/devel/glib2/PLIST Thu Apr 10 12:13:32 2008 +0000
+++ b/devel/glib2/PLIST Thu Apr 10 12:13:49 2008 +0000
@@ -1,8 +1,54 @@
-@comment $NetBSD: PLIST,v 1.38 2007/09/18 17:37:02 tnn Exp $
+@comment $NetBSD: PLIST,v 1.39 2008/04/10 12:13:49 drochner Exp $
 bin/glib-genmarshal
 bin/glib-gettextize
 bin/glib-mkenums
 bin/gobject-query
+bin/gtester
+bin/gtester-report
+include/glib/gio-unix-2.0/gio/gdesktopappinfo.h
+include/glib/gio-unix-2.0/gio/gunixinputstream.h
+include/glib/gio-unix-2.0/gio/gunixmounts.h
+include/glib/gio-unix-2.0/gio/gunixoutputstream.h
+include/glib/glib-2.0/gio/gappinfo.h
+include/glib/glib-2.0/gio/gasyncresult.h
+include/glib/glib-2.0/gio/gbufferedinputstream.h
+include/glib/glib-2.0/gio/gbufferedoutputstream.h
+include/glib/glib-2.0/gio/gcancellable.h
+include/glib/glib-2.0/gio/gcontenttype.h
+include/glib/glib-2.0/gio/gdatainputstream.h
+include/glib/glib-2.0/gio/gdataoutputstream.h
+include/glib/glib-2.0/gio/gdrive.h
+include/glib/glib-2.0/gio/gfile.h
+include/glib/glib-2.0/gio/gfileattribute.h
+include/glib/glib-2.0/gio/gfileenumerator.h
+include/glib/glib-2.0/gio/gfileicon.h
+include/glib/glib-2.0/gio/gfileinfo.h
+include/glib/glib-2.0/gio/gfileinputstream.h
+include/glib/glib-2.0/gio/gfilemonitor.h
+include/glib/glib-2.0/gio/gfilenamecompleter.h
+include/glib/glib-2.0/gio/gfileoutputstream.h
+include/glib/glib-2.0/gio/gfilterinputstream.h
+include/glib/glib-2.0/gio/gfilteroutputstream.h
+include/glib/glib-2.0/gio/gicon.h
+include/glib/glib-2.0/gio/ginputstream.h
+include/glib/glib-2.0/gio/gio.h
+include/glib/glib-2.0/gio/gioenumtypes.h
+include/glib/glib-2.0/gio/gioerror.h
+include/glib/glib-2.0/gio/giomodule.h
+include/glib/glib-2.0/gio/gioscheduler.h
+include/glib/glib-2.0/gio/gloadableicon.h
+include/glib/glib-2.0/gio/gmemoryinputstream.h
+include/glib/glib-2.0/gio/gmemoryoutputstream.h
+include/glib/glib-2.0/gio/gmount.h
+include/glib/glib-2.0/gio/gmountoperation.h
+include/glib/glib-2.0/gio/gnativevolumemonitor.h
+include/glib/glib-2.0/gio/goutputstream.h
+include/glib/glib-2.0/gio/gseekable.h
+include/glib/glib-2.0/gio/gsimpleasyncresult.h
+include/glib/glib-2.0/gio/gthemedicon.h
+include/glib/glib-2.0/gio/gvfs.h
+include/glib/glib-2.0/gio/gvolume.h
+include/glib/glib-2.0/gio/gvolumemonitor.h
 include/glib/glib-2.0/glib-object.h
 include/glib/glib-2.0/glib.h
 include/glib/glib-2.0/glib/galloca.h
@@ -13,6 +59,7 @@
 include/glib/glib-2.0/glib/gbase64.h
 include/glib/glib-2.0/glib/gbookmarkfile.h
 include/glib/glib-2.0/glib/gcache.h
+include/glib/glib-2.0/glib/gchecksum.h
 include/glib/glib-2.0/glib/gcompletion.h
 include/glib/glib-2.0/glib/gconvert.h
 include/glib/glib-2.0/glib/gdataset.h
@@ -44,8 +91,8 @@
 include/glib/glib-2.0/glib/grand.h
 include/glib/glib-2.0/glib/gregex.h
 include/glib/glib-2.0/glib/grel.h
+include/glib/glib-2.0/glib/gscanner.h
 include/glib/glib-2.0/glib/gsequence.h
-include/glib/glib-2.0/glib/gscanner.h
 include/glib/glib-2.0/glib/gshell.h
 include/glib/glib-2.0/glib/gslice.h
 include/glib/glib-2.0/glib/gslist.h
@@ -53,12 +100,14 @@
 include/glib/glib-2.0/glib/gstdio.h
 include/glib/glib-2.0/glib/gstrfuncs.h
 include/glib/glib-2.0/glib/gstring.h
+include/glib/glib-2.0/glib/gtestutils.h
 include/glib/glib-2.0/glib/gthread.h
 include/glib/glib-2.0/glib/gthreadpool.h
 include/glib/glib-2.0/glib/gtimer.h
 include/glib/glib-2.0/glib/gtree.h
 include/glib/glib-2.0/glib/gtypes.h
 include/glib/glib-2.0/glib/gunicode.h
+include/glib/glib-2.0/glib/gurifuncs.h
 include/glib/glib-2.0/glib/gutils.h
 include/glib/glib-2.0/glib/gwin32.h
 include/glib/glib-2.0/gmodule.h
@@ -79,11 +128,15 @@
 include/glib/glib-2.0/gobject/gvaluearray.h
 include/glib/glib-2.0/gobject/gvaluecollector.h
 include/glib/glib-2.0/gobject/gvaluetypes.h
+lib/gio/modules/libgiofam.la
 lib/glib-2.0/include/glibconfig.h
+lib/libgio-2.0.la
 lib/libglib-2.0.la
 lib/libgmodule-2.0.la
 lib/libgobject-2.0.la
 lib/libgthread-2.0.la
+lib/pkgconfig/gio-2.0.pc
+lib/pkgconfig/gio-unix-2.0.pc
 lib/pkgconfig/glib-2.0.pc
 lib/pkgconfig/gmodule-2.0.pc
 lib/pkgconfig/gmodule-export-2.0.pc
@@ -98,6 +151,80 @@
 share/aclocal/glib-gettext.m4
 share/glib-2.0/gettext/mkinstalldirs
 share/glib-2.0/gettext/po/Makefile.in.in
+share/gtk-doc/html/gio/GAppInfo.html
+share/gtk-doc/html/gio/GAsyncResult.html
+share/gtk-doc/html/gio/GBufferedInputStream.html
+share/gtk-doc/html/gio/GBufferedOutputStream.html
+share/gtk-doc/html/gio/GCancellable.html
+share/gtk-doc/html/gio/GDataInputStream.html
+share/gtk-doc/html/gio/GDataOutputStream.html
+share/gtk-doc/html/gio/GDrive.html
+share/gtk-doc/html/gio/GFile.html
+share/gtk-doc/html/gio/GFileEnumerator.html
+share/gtk-doc/html/gio/GFileIcon.html
+share/gtk-doc/html/gio/GFileInfo.html
+share/gtk-doc/html/gio/GFileInputStream.html
+share/gtk-doc/html/gio/GFileMonitor.html
+share/gtk-doc/html/gio/GFileOutputStream.html
+share/gtk-doc/html/gio/GFilenameCompleter.html
+share/gtk-doc/html/gio/GFilterInputStream.html
+share/gtk-doc/html/gio/GFilterOutputStream.html
+share/gtk-doc/html/gio/GIOModule.html
+share/gtk-doc/html/gio/GIcon.html
+share/gtk-doc/html/gio/GInputStream.html
+share/gtk-doc/html/gio/GLoadableIcon.html
+share/gtk-doc/html/gio/GMemoryInputStream.html
+share/gtk-doc/html/gio/GMemoryOutputStream.html
+share/gtk-doc/html/gio/GMount.html
+share/gtk-doc/html/gio/GMountOperation.html
+share/gtk-doc/html/gio/GOutputStream.html
+share/gtk-doc/html/gio/GSeekable.html
+share/gtk-doc/html/gio/GSimpleAsyncResult.html
+share/gtk-doc/html/gio/GThemedIcon.html
+share/gtk-doc/html/gio/GUnixInputStream.html
+share/gtk-doc/html/gio/GUnixOutputStream.html
+share/gtk-doc/html/gio/GVfs.html
+share/gtk-doc/html/gio/GVolume.html
+share/gtk-doc/html/gio/GVolumeMonitor.html
+share/gtk-doc/html/gio/async.html
+share/gtk-doc/html/gio/ch01.html
+share/gtk-doc/html/gio/ch02.html
+share/gtk-doc/html/gio/ch03.html
+share/gtk-doc/html/gio/ch14.html
+share/gtk-doc/html/gio/ch15.html
+share/gtk-doc/html/gio/ch15s02.html
+share/gtk-doc/html/gio/ch15s03.html
+share/gtk-doc/html/gio/extending.html
+share/gtk-doc/html/gio/file_mon.html
+share/gtk-doc/html/gio/file_ops.html
+share/gtk-doc/html/gio/gio-Desktop-file-based-GAppInfo.html
+share/gtk-doc/html/gio/gio-Extension-Points.html
+share/gtk-doc/html/gio/gio-GContentType.html
+share/gtk-doc/html/gio/gio-GFileAttribute.html
+share/gtk-doc/html/gio/gio-GIOError.html
+share/gtk-doc/html/gio/gio-GIOScheduler.html
+share/gtk-doc/html/gio/gio-Unix-Mounts.html
+share/gtk-doc/html/gio/gio-extension-points.html
+share/gtk-doc/html/gio/gio-hierarchy.html
+share/gtk-doc/html/gio/gio.devhelp
+share/gtk-doc/html/gio/gio.devhelp2
+share/gtk-doc/html/gio/gvfs-overview.png
+share/gtk-doc/html/gio/home.png
+share/gtk-doc/html/gio/icons.html
+share/gtk-doc/html/gio/index.html
+share/gtk-doc/html/gio/index.sgml
+share/gtk-doc/html/gio/ix01.html
+share/gtk-doc/html/gio/left.png
+share/gtk-doc/html/gio/migrating.html
+share/gtk-doc/html/gio/pt01.html
+share/gtk-doc/html/gio/pt02.html
+share/gtk-doc/html/gio/right.png
+share/gtk-doc/html/gio/streaming.html
+share/gtk-doc/html/gio/style.css
+share/gtk-doc/html/gio/types.html
+share/gtk-doc/html/gio/up.png
+share/gtk-doc/html/gio/utils.html
+share/gtk-doc/html/gio/volume_mon.html
 share/gtk-doc/html/glib/file-name-encodings.png
 share/gtk-doc/html/glib/glib-Arrays.html
 share/gtk-doc/html/glib/glib-Asynchronous-Queues.html
@@ -112,6 +239,7 @@
 share/gtk-doc/html/glib/glib-Caches.html
 share/gtk-doc/html/glib/glib-Character-Set-Conversion.html
 share/gtk-doc/html/glib/glib-Commandline-option-parser.html
+share/gtk-doc/html/glib/glib-Data-Checksums.html
 share/gtk-doc/html/glib/glib-Datasets.html
 share/gtk-doc/html/glib/glib-Date-and-Time-Functions.html
 share/gtk-doc/html/glib/glib-Double-ended-Queues.html
@@ -151,12 +279,14 @@
 share/gtk-doc/html/glib/glib-String-Chunks.html
 share/gtk-doc/html/glib/glib-String-Utility-Functions.html
 share/gtk-doc/html/glib/glib-Strings.html
+share/gtk-doc/html/glib/glib-Testing.html
 share/gtk-doc/html/glib/glib-The-Main-Event-Loop.html
 share/gtk-doc/html/glib/glib-Thread-Pools.html
 share/gtk-doc/html/glib/glib-Threads.html
 share/gtk-doc/html/glib/glib-Timers.html
 share/gtk-doc/html/glib/glib-Trash-Stacks.html
 share/gtk-doc/html/glib/glib-Type-Conversion-Macros.html
+share/gtk-doc/html/glib/glib-URI-Functions.html
 share/gtk-doc/html/glib/glib-Unicode-Manipulation.html
 share/gtk-doc/html/glib/glib-Version-Information.html
 share/gtk-doc/html/glib/glib-Warnings-and-Assertions.html
@@ -169,8 +299,8 @@
 share/gtk-doc/html/glib/glib-data-types.html
 share/gtk-doc/html/glib/glib-fundamentals.html
 share/gtk-doc/html/glib/glib-gettextize.html
+share/gtk-doc/html/glib/glib-regex-syntax.html
 share/gtk-doc/html/glib/glib-resources.html
-share/gtk-doc/html/glib/glib-regex-syntax.html
 share/gtk-doc/html/glib/glib-running.html
 share/gtk-doc/html/glib/glib-utilities.html
 share/gtk-doc/html/glib/glib.devhelp
@@ -188,6 +318,7 @@
 share/gtk-doc/html/glib/ix07.html
 share/gtk-doc/html/glib/ix08.html
 share/gtk-doc/html/glib/ix09.html
+share/gtk-doc/html/glib/ix10.html
 share/gtk-doc/html/glib/left.png
 share/gtk-doc/html/glib/mainloop-states.gif
 share/gtk-doc/html/glib/right.png
@@ -200,9 +331,9 @@
 share/gtk-doc/html/gobject/ch06s03.html
 share/gtk-doc/html/gobject/ch07s02.html
 share/gtk-doc/html/gobject/ch07s03.html
-share/gtk-doc/html/gobject/chapter-intro.html
 share/gtk-doc/html/gobject/chapter-gobject.html
 share/gtk-doc/html/gobject/chapter-gtype.html
+share/gtk-doc/html/gobject/chapter-intro.html
 share/gtk-doc/html/gobject/chapter-signal.html
 share/gtk-doc/html/gobject/glib-genmarshal.html
 share/gtk-doc/html/gobject/glib-mkenums.html
@@ -312,6 +443,7 @@
 share/locale/mk/LC_MESSAGES/glib20.mo
 share/locale/ml/LC_MESSAGES/glib20.mo
 share/locale/mn/LC_MESSAGES/glib20.mo
+share/locale/mr/LC_MESSAGES/glib20.mo
 share/locale/ms/LC_MESSAGES/glib20.mo
 share/locale/nb/LC_MESSAGES/glib20.mo
 share/locale/ne/LC_MESSAGES/glib20.mo
@@ -326,6 +458,7 @@



Home | Main Index | Thread Index | Old Index